Output 42220490512e07813ba5ac68f02f399c40bc089e9d5ae68e5da29c67b90b7b94:2

value
529758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b4827052f83763e9920501bbc6b047dad60e1e OP_EQUAL
address
3DWqLK2eSuxEYXZRPzjpxbGJP3we1XAE3x
transaction
42220490512e07813ba5ac68f02f399c40bc089e9d5ae68e5da29c67b90b7b94
spent
true